Commenting on a story about moves to allow pharmacists to prescribe emergency contraception, the editor of CovenantNews.com offers the following:
Editor asks, What does the future hold for a nation possessed by the Spirit of Murder? With each expansion of death comes escalation. Local churches hold silent prayer vigils outside Eckerd Drugs? Anti-abortion protest at local drug stores? Drug Store ‘Escorts’ volunteer at CVS Pharmacies? Off duty cops moonlight at abortion-drug stores? Local Right to Life director opposes protesters and graphic pro-life signs at drug stores? Operation Rescue holds sit-in at abortion-drug store? Court creates ‘Buffer Zones’ around abortion-drug stores? U.S. Congress adds ‘Pharmacies’ to the Freedom of Accsess to Clinic Enterance Act, President said he will sign bill into law? Fire guts local drug store, FBI suspects arson? Pharmacist is keynote speaker at NARAL fund raiser? Pharmacists wear bulletproof vests?
That’s interesting.
Why would a “pro-life” blogger imagine that providing safe and legal contraceptive services would result in protests, blockades, security details, harassment, sit-ins, arsons, and shootings? We were told over and over that those tactics – rampant at abortion clinics, with deadly results – are not representative of the anti-choice movement, that they (in their thousands, over and over, year after year) were each and every time spontaneous aberrations caused by a few “bad apples”. Now “pro-lifers” themselves are predicting “escalation” of the characteristic violence of the anti-choice religious right in response to the newest reproductive-health technology.
I suspect many supporters of women’s rights have the same expectation, but it would sound accusatory if we said it. I think we should take “pro-lifers” at their word – and prepare for the worst.
